Before spending on detailed architectural drawings for a site in Whitstable, outline planning permission establishes whether the council will accept the scheme in principle – scale, use, and general layout – with finer detail like appearance and landscaping settled later as reserved matters. Do larger schemes take longer to determine in Whitstable?

Yes, significantly – a small Whitstable scheme usually sees an 8-week determination, while a major development can take 13 weeks or longer depending on complexity.

Who typically needs outline planning permission in Whitstable?

It suits developers, land owners, and anyone with a larger or more complex Whitstable scheme who wants confirmation the principle of development is acceptable before investing in detailed design.
